Family tree Jans » Pieternella Dirgje van ES (1882-1949)

Personal data Pieternella Dirgje van ES 


Household of Pieternella Dirgje van ES

She is married to Pieter MANS.

They got married in the year 1909 at Aalburg, she was 26 years old.


Child(ren):

  1. Dirk MANS  1916-1978
